On November 22, the children's creative center "Endanik" of the Ministry of Education and Science organized an exhibition of handicrafts of students of tapestry, carpet and embroidery workshops at the school N11 of Gyumri. The aim of the exhibition was to arouse interest in national art and crafts, to consider the importance of the role and significance of Armenian crafts in the process of preserving culture, as well as to present the skills and creative skills of students.
During the event, the students of the school, teachers and interested parents were introduced to the specific features of tapestry, carpet and embroidery, and they carried out the work process by involving the students of the school.
The headmistress of the school A. Grigorian expressed her gratitude to the organizers of the exhibition for associating the students with the branches of national art and crafts.
